    While visiting Buckeye Lake, I learned that Weldon's Ice Cream Factory is the place to visit. It's…read morean institution, and it has been around since 1930! I'm not a big ice cream person, but I do love sweets, especially a sweets shop with history. I ordered a banana split. Though, it was difficult to decide what to order! This place has a peaceful vibe, but the signage is a little chaotic -- it's like walking up to a Dr. Bronner's bottle. I had to stand there for a bit and read everything while the poor girl behind the counter waited for me to get my bearings. (Luckily I was the only one in the shop at the time.) There are different colored signs everywhere, listing daily specials, new items, and things you can buy that aren't ice cream, like bags of ice and local honey. The banana split was delicious: A perfectly ripe banana split between two scoops of ice cream -- I chose vanilla and chocolate. It's topped with whipped cream, crushed nuts, and a cherry on top. It's one of those desserts where you lose track of time when you eat it, or at least I did. All of my concentration went toward eating that magnificent ice cream concoction as quickly as possible. I decided to shovel it into my face on the big porch, which overlooks the Buckeye Lake canal. There is also seating indoors, too. Weldon's is a must-visit if you're in the Buckeye Lake area!
